thanks bat . um the t3 comes with different size wheels on the compressor . these tend to vary mostly in the id of the inlet blades ,or inducer.the cossie t3 prob has an inducer of 46 mm ish.the t3 on a metro has an inducer of 37mm ish ,its known as the 40 trim wheel i think.so i was curious to know how much bhp it can supply ,and wether anyone out there has reached a bhp ceiling due to using the 40 trim wheel .as i say .im guessing at 190 ,but would be interested to see if this info its out there .regards robert. no sweat gavin ,i appreciate your trying to help.the info in compressor maps i had allready ,i can see that a 40 trim would flow enough air for 200 plus ,but that if yuo need to step the boost higher than about 25 ,you get less and less efficient ( cool ),air,and theres a sort of tip over point in turbos where the boost increase actually reduces the efficiency of the turbo to the point where yuo dont get more power ,and can actually get less,.regards robert.
